LCA is committed to staff development. In addition to attendance at the Annual ACSI Educator’s Convention, four or five days are set aside each year for continuing education in educational and Biblical studies. Our administrator is certified by ACSI to teach continuing education courses that are recognized for teacher certification. This past year five of our instructional staff were involved in college level courses, four at the graduate level. Every teacher is required to advance his or her education. ACSI certification is the required credential that all teachers must pursue.
